#!/usr/bin/env bash
# probe.sh — deterministic runner-capability probe. Every measurement degrades
# to a "null" value (still a recorded line) when a tool is missing; the job
# NEVER fails from the probe itself.
#
# Measurements:
# probe-cpu single-core shell-arithmetic loop throughput (kops/s over a
# fixed 1,000,000-iteration loop)
# probe-write sequential write throughput (dd 2 GiB to the job scratch
# dir, then removed)
# probe-read sequential read throughput of that same file
# probe-fs-type filesystem type of the scratch dir
# probe-fs-free free space of the scratch dir (MB)
#
# Usage: run from the repo root (the scripts/ dir next to workloads/):
# bash workloads/probe/probe.sh
set -u
REPO_ROOT=$(cd "$(dirname "$0")/../.." && pwd)
# shellcheck disable=SC1091
. "$REPO_ROOT/scripts/emit_timing.sh"
# Scratch dir: the runner's temp when we have one, else mktemp -d.
PROBE_DIR=${RUNNER_TEMP:-${TMPDIR:-/tmp}}
mkdir -p "$PROBE_DIR" 2>/dev/null || PROBE_DIR=$(mktemp -d)
PROBE_BIN=$PROBE_DIR/probe.bin
now_s() { # fractional seconds, best available clock
local t
t=$(date -u +%s.%N 2>/dev/null || true)
case $t in
*N) t=$(python3 -c 'import time; print(f"{time.time():.6f}")' 2>/dev/null || echo '') ;;
esac
[ -n "$t" ] || t=$(date +%s).000
printf '%s\n' "$t"
}
probe_cpu() {
if ! command -v python3 >/dev/null 2>&1 && ! command -v bc >/dev/null 2>&1; then
bench_metric probe-cpu null kops_per_s # no fractional clock available
return 0
fi
local iters=1000000 t0 t1 elapsed
t0=$(now_s)
local i=0
while [ "$i" -lt "$iters" ]; do
i=$((i + 1))
done
t1=$(now_s)
if command -v python3 >/dev/null 2>&1; then
elapsed=$(python3 -c "print(f'{$t1 - $t0:.6f}')")
else
elapsed=$(echo "$t1 - $t0" | bc -l)
fi
bench_metric probe-cpu "$(python3 -c "print(f'{$iters / $elapsed / 1000:.2f}')" 2>/dev/null \
|| echo "$iters $elapsed" | awk '{printf "%.2f", $1 / $2 / 1000}')" kops_per_s
}
# Parse the "bytes ... copied/transferred in N s" line dd writes to stderr.
# GNU: "X bytes (...) copied, 3.123 s, ...". BSD: "X bytes transferred in
# 3.123456 secs". Prints "BYTES SECONDS" on stdout, nothing when unmatched.
# ERE (-E) because BSD sed has no BRE alternation.
parse_dd() {
sed -nE 's/^([0-9]+) bytes.*[ ,] ?([0-9.]+) s.*/\1 \2/p'
}
probe_write() {
command -v dd >/dev/null 2>&1 || { bench_metric probe-write null MB_per_s; return 0; }
local out
out=$(dd if=/dev/zero of="$PROBE_BIN" bs=1M count=2048 2>&1) || true
local parsed
parsed=$(printf '%s\n' "$out" | parse_dd)
if [ -z "$parsed" ]; then
bench_metric probe-write null MB_per_s
return 0
fi
set -- $parsed
bench_metric probe-write "$(awk -v b="$1" -v s="$2" 'BEGIN { printf "%.1f", b / s / 1000000 }')" MB_per_s
}
probe_read() {
if [ ! -f "$PROBE_BIN" ]; then
bench_metric probe-read null MB_per_s # write probe never produced it
return 0
fi
command -v dd >/dev/null 2>&1 || { bench_metric probe-read null MB_per_s; return 0; }
# Drop the page cache when we can (best effort, usually not permitted);
# otherwise this measures warm cache — still comparable across platforms.
sync 2>/dev/null || true
local out
out=$(dd if="$PROBE_BIN" of=/dev/null bs=1M 2>&1) || true
local parsed
parsed=$(printf '%s\n' "$out" | parse_dd)
if [ -z "$parsed" ]; then
bench_metric probe-read null MB_per_s
return 0
fi
set -- $parsed
bench_metric probe-read "$(awk -v b="$1" -v s="$2" 'BEGIN { printf "%.1f", b / s / 1000000 }')" MB_per_s
}
probe_fs() {
# Filesystem type: GNU stat -f -c %T, BSD stat -f %T, else null.
local fstype=null
if stat -f -c %T "$PROBE_DIR" >/dev/null 2>&1; then
fstype='"'$(stat -f -c %T "$PROBE_DIR" 2>/dev/null)'"'
elif stat -f %T "$PROBE_DIR" >/dev/null 2>&1; then
fstype='"'$(stat -f %T "$PROBE_DIR" 2>/dev/null | tr -d '"')'"'
fi
bench_metric probe-fs-type "$fstype" fstype
# Free space in MB via df -k (POSIX), else null.
if command -v df >/dev/null 2>&1; then
local free_kb
free_kb=$(df -Pk "$PROBE_DIR" 2>/dev/null | awk 'NR==2 {print $4}') || free_kb=''
case $free_kb in
''|*[!0-9]*) bench_metric probe-fs-free null MB ;;
*) bench_metric probe-fs-free "$((free_kb / 1024))" MB ;;
esac
else
bench_metric probe-fs-free null MB
fi
}
probe_cpu
probe_write
probe_read
rm -f "$PROBE_BIN" 2>/dev/null || true
probe_fs
exit 0
